From c73b2afcf11a1041dc2893e1e69868316820e351 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Andrea D'Amore <a@d-amo.re>
Date: Sun, 24 Feb 2019 16:20:58 +0100
Subject: [PATCH] index.org: Mention Orga and Pandoc in the tool page
* index.org (Org-mode parsers): add link to homepage and brief description for
Orga, an ES parsers for org, and Pandoc, the multi-purpose converter.
TINYCHANGE
---
org-tools/index.org | 11 +++++++++++
1 file changed, 11 insertions(+)
diff --git a/org-tools/index.org b/org-tools/index.org
index 53a01963..3b6a5035 100644
--- a/org-tools/index.org
+++ b/org-tools/index.org
@@ -111,6 +111,17 @@ org-js is a javascript parser and converter for org-mode
For a working example of an interactive editor, see
http://mooz.github.com/org-js/editor/.
+** [[https://github.com//xiaoxinghu/orgajs][orga]] by Xiaoxing Hu
+
+Orga is a flexible org-mode syntax parser. It parses org content into
+AST (Abstract Syntax Tree).
+
+** [[https://pandoc.org][pandoc]]
+
+Pandoc is the Swiss-army knife to convert files from one markup format
+into another, it can convert documents from many source format,
+including Org-Mode, to many other.
+
